Action item 3 (owner: scheduling guild): document and standardize the cron drift tolerances uncovered during the Marlowette incident review. We found each service on the Quillbank cluster had invented its own slack window, which masked the 40-minute skew for days. New team members should treat the following values as the single source of truth for drift detection.

tuning table, kajog-bawip:
TIERS = {
    "kelius": 256,
    "lammir": 543,
}

Onboarding note for the weekly eng sync: the Harrowmill platform enforces per-tenant rate quotas at the Lattice ingress layer. Quotas are defined in the tenant manifest and take effect on the next config rollout, so changes should land before Thursday's deploy window. Any quota manifest pushed to production must be signed, or the rollout controller rejects it. The current manifest signing key appears below.

release key, yafog-kadug: bky13_ADqM5YQWZutLX

Subject: Handover — validator plugin stuff

Hey Priya,

Passing you the baton on Checkwright, our plugin system for data validators. The new schema-drift plugin shipped Tuesday and mostly behaves, but it occasionally flags empty CSV uploads as "malformed" — harmless, just noisy. I've muted the alert until Friday. If support escalates anything about plugin load failures, the fix is usually bumping the registry cache. Questions after I'm off? Reach the Checkwright maintainers at the address below.

billing contact of hawip-kahif = zorwyn@tolvaqlabs.corp

Onboarding note for the Ledgerpane admin table: bulk edits are applied through the batcher service, not directly against the database. Select rows, choose an action, and the batcher stages changes in a pending set you can review before commit. Edits over 500 rows require a second approver — this is enforced server-side, so don't try to chunk around it. To run the batcher locally you need the staging write credential, which goes in your .env as the next line.

secret setting of bahip-kagag: RELAY_SECRET3=c83